217. Contains Duplicate

如果一个数组里所有数都不同,则返回false

如果有重复数字,则返回true

C++(36ms):

 1 class Solution {
 2 public:
 3     bool containsDuplicate(vector<int>& nums) {
 4         int len1 = nums.size() ;
 5         set<int> s(nums.begin() , nums.end()) ;
 6         int len2 = s.size() ;
 7         if (len1 == len2)
 8             return false ;
 9         else
10             return true ;
11     }
12 };
原文地址:https://www.cnblogs.com/mengchunchen/p/7515696.html